public function ExpressionBase::getUuid in Rules 8.3
Returns the UUID of this expression if it is nested in another expression.
Return value
string|null The UUID if this expression is nested or NULL if it does not have a UUID.
Overrides ExpressionInterface::getUuid
5 calls to ExpressionBase::getUuid()
- ActionExpression::checkIntegrity in src/
Plugin/ RulesExpression/ ActionExpression.php - Verifies that this expression is configured correctly.
- ActionExpression::prepareExecutionMetadataState in src/
Plugin/ RulesExpression/ ActionExpression.php - Prepares the execution metadata state by adding metadata to it.
- ConditionExpression::checkIntegrity in src/
Plugin/ RulesExpression/ ConditionExpression.php - Verifies that this expression is configured correctly.
- ConditionExpression::prepareExecutionMetadataState in src/
Plugin/ RulesExpression/ ConditionExpression.php - Prepares the execution metadata state by adding metadata to it.
- ExpressionContainerBase::prepareExecutionMetadataState in src/
Engine/ ExpressionContainerBase.php - Prepares the execution metadata state by adding metadata to it.
File
- src/
Engine/ ExpressionBase.php, line 153
Class
- ExpressionBase
- Base class for rules expressions.
Namespace
Drupal\rules\EngineCode
public function getUuid() {
return $this->uuid;
}